Как понимать означают тестовые инфраструктуры

Как понимать означают тестовые инфраструктуры

Проверочные инфраструктуры представляют из себя отдельные окружения, во каких оценивается действие цифрового ПО до данного ПО применения в главной платформе. Такие среды формируются для того, чтобы находить сбои, проверять реакцию сервиса плюс оценивать стабильность обновлений при отсутствии риска по отношению к стабильной работы решения. Подобные среды повторяют параметры реальной использования, но не up x воздействуют на аудиторию и основные сценарии.

При процессе программирования проверочные инфраструктуры играют значимую функцию. Дополнительные ресурсы, подобные например ап х, дают возможность выяснить устройство инфраструктур и основы их применения. Ключевое внимание отводится точности имитации параметров, стабильности работы а также потенциалу безопасного проверки различных сценариев.

Роль проверочных сред

Главная задача проверочной инфраструктуры — создать защищенное окружение с целью тестирования правок. Всякая дополнительная функция, исправление сбоя а также обновление сервиса первоначально валидируется во самостоятельном пространстве. Данное помогает выявить сбои до момента, пока эти проблемы воздействуют при рабочую инфраструктуру.

Испытательные среды тоже используются для проверки согласованности. Программа способно взаимодействовать через базами информации, подключенными службами плюс служебными элементами. При испытательной инфраструктуре можно проверить, что все модули работают ап икс официальный сайт корректно совместно.

Еще отдельной целью становится проверка производительности. Во проверочном окружении имитируется активность, чтобы определить, как платформа ведет работу при значительном объеме операций. Это помогает выявить слабые участки плюс сначала адаптироваться под повышению нагрузки.

Категории тестовых сред

Имеется набор видов проверочных инфраструктур. Создание как правило начинается во местной инфраструктуре, где инженер проверяет частные правки. Такая инфраструктура выделяется сильной подвижностью а также дает возможность оперативно добавлять корректировки.

Очередным этапом является межкомпонентная инфраструктура. В ней тестируется связь нескольких компонентов сервиса. Главная задача — убедиться, если компоненты стабильно передают информацией и никак не создают сбоев.

Staging-окружение почти полностью адаптирована до рабочей. Во этой среде проверяется финальная редакция сервиса до публикацией. Данное дает возможность оценить работу системы во настройках, приближенных к реальным.

Также способна задействоваться самостоятельная инфраструктура для нагрузочного испытания. При ней формируется сильная нагрузка, чтобы оценить устойчивость платформы плюс данной системы возможность обрабатывать крупное количество обращений.

Организация тестовой инфраструктуры

Проверочная среда охватывает ряд элементов. Базу создает стенд а также набор серверов, на данных размещается сервис. Кроме того задействуются базы информации, решения размещения плюс интернет up x модули.

Параметры инфраструктуры обязана отвечать рабочим условиям. Такое касается редакций программного ПО, конфигураций машин плюс организации информации. Насколько детальнее среда повторяет боевую платформу, в таком случае точнее выводы проверки.

Также способны задействоваться синтетические сведения. Они повторяют реальные данные, при этом не включают конфиденциальной информации. Данные наборы помогают валидировать механику работы сервиса при отсутствии риска раскрытия данных.

Управление сведениями в испытательной среде

Взаимодействие по данными требует специального подхода. Во испытательной инфраструктуре задействуются дубликаты либо специально подготовленные комплекты ап икс официальный сайт данных. Данное помогает воспроизводить различные варианты плюс проверять работу системы при многообразных режимах.

Необходимо отслеживать свежесть сведений. Если информация потеряла актуальность, итоги валидации имеют возможность являться ошибочными. Следовательно данные регулярно обновляются либо создаются с нуля.

Дополнительно необходимо принимать сохранность. Испытательные данные совсем не могут включать фактическую частную данные. Ради данного используются механизмы обезличивания и ап икс формирования искусственных сведений.

Автоматизация тестовых сред

Актуальные платформы создания активно применяют автоматизацию. Испытательные инфраструктуры имеют возможность создаваться а также настраиваться самостоятельно. Данное позволяет своевременно разворачивать окружение для проверки правок.

Автоматизация охватывает настройку машин, загрузку библиотек и загрузку данных. Данный подход сокращает частоту сбоев и облегчает процесс валидации.

Дополнительно автоматизируется очистка а также пересоздание окружения. Затем прохождения проверки контур имеет возможность стать сброшено или развернуто повторно. Данное сохраняет устойчивость плюс исключает увеличение ошибок up x.

Связь с CI/CD циклами

Испытательные инфраструктуры прочно объединены через CI/CD. В случае очередном обновлении проекта автоматически выполняются процессы, что задействуют проверочные инфраструктуры ради тестирования. Это помогает оперативно обнаруживать дефекты плюс снижать таких сбоев распространение.

Любой этап CI/CD способен применять конкретную среду. Например, интеграционные тесты запускаются в одной среде, при этом финальная валидация — при отдельной. Подобный метод усиливает устойчивость сервиса.

Самостоятельное обращение через тестовыми инфраструктурами делает цикл программирования гораздо предсказуемым. Все изменения выполняют одинаковую схему валидаций.

Контроль корректности

Контроль корректности становится важной функцией проверочных окружений. При них запускаются разные типы валидации: сценарное, связующее, нагрузочное плюс регрессионное. Каждый формат проверки проверяет заданный аспект функционирования системы.

Выводы проверки сохраняются плюс оцениваются. Если обнаружены сбои, правки отправляются для исправление. Это снижает попадание сбоев ап икс во боевую среду.

Постоянное тестирование помогает поддерживать устойчивость платформы. Даже ограниченные правки имеют возможность воздействовать по действие программы, поэтому тестирование проводится систематически.

Типичные проблемы в процессе применении тестовых инфраструктур

Одной среди распространенных проблем выступает несоответствие окружения рабочим условиям. Когда параметры отличается, итоги тестирования имеют возможность оказаться неточными. Это приводит до дефектам затем деплоя.

Кроме того одной проблемой является применение неактуальных сведений. Во таком варианте проверка никак не демонстрирует up x реальную картину, а также сбои имеют возможность оказаться невыявленными.

Также появляется недостаточная изоляция. Если испытательная среда объединена с продуктовой системой, существует риск эффекта на реальные данные. Это может создать путь в опасным инцидентам.

Безопасность тестовых инфраструктур

Тестовые инфраструктуры обязаны оказаться защищены аналогично же, аналогично плюс продуктовые платформы. Такие среды могут хранить важную информацию про архитектуре программы и его схеме. Следовательно доступ ап икс официальный сайт до этим средам обязан являться закрыт.

Применяются способы ограничения входа, кодирования а также контроля. Такое дает возможность предотвратить незаконное использование инфраструктуры.

Дополнительно важно следить над актуализацией цифрового обеспечения. Неактуальные элементы способны включать риски, какие способны быть применены злоумышленниками ап икс.

Наблюдение испытательных инфраструктур

Наблюдение дает возможность контролировать работу тестовой области. Такой процесс демонстрирует занятость мощностей, ошибки плюс скорость. Данное помогает находить сбои совсем не исключительно в приложении, а и при собственной инфраструктуре.

Периодическое отслеживание дает возможность обеспечивать устойчивость инфраструктуры. Когда ресурсы заканчиваются а также формируются ошибки, данное способно воздействовать при итоги валидации.

Мониторинг тоже дает возможность улучшать расход средств. Это очень значимо в случае взаимодействии через разными средами параллельно.

Дополнительные направления тестовых инфраструктур

Ключевым в числе существенных элементов выступает управление вариантами инфраструктуры. Отдельные стадии разработки могут требовать отдельных параметров а также условий. Потому ап икс официальный сайт следует фиксировать условия инфраструктуры плюс наблюдать правки. Данное дает возможность повторять условия проверки и снижать расхождений внутри итогами.

Дополнительно задействуется подход краткосрочных сред. Для любой операции либо проверки формируется отдельная область, какая устраняется затем окончания работы. Данное помогает валидировать обновления отдельно плюс снижает частоту расхождений между различными сборками приложения.

Еще отдельным аспектом становится интеграция по средствами разработки. Проверочные окружения способны программно ап икс подключаться к системам контроля версий, CI/CD пайплайнам и решениям мониторинга. Такое создает механизм проверки намного удобным а также удобным.

Оптимизация эксплуатации проверочных инфраструктур

С целью стабильной эксплуатации необходимо оптимизировать средства. Развертывание и обслуживание среды предполагает серверных ресурсов, поэтому необходимо контролировать такие мощности расход. Программное деактивация ненужных инфраструктур помогает up x снизить нагрузку.

Улучшение дополнительно охватывает организацию процессов. Совсем не любые тесты должны выполняться в общей области. Деление операций среди инфраструктурами повышает скорость проверку плюс уменьшает длительность задержки.

Регулярный анализ использования проверочных инфраструктур помогает находить слабые зоны. Когда проверки выполняются долго а также часто появляются ошибки, настройки следует обновлять. Данное делает платформу намного устойчивой и эффективной ап икс официальный сайт.

Прикладное назначение проверочных окружений

Испытательные среды задействуются во многих стадиях создания. Такие среды помогают обнаруживать дефекты, тестировать правки плюс улучшать качество решения. Без данных окружений вероятность ошибок в продуктовой инфраструктуре существенно повышается.

Правильно организованные тестовые окружения формируют процесс создания более предсказуемым. Каждое обновление проходит валидацию, что снижает частоту неожиданных сбоев.

Осознание основ работы проверочных сред помогает точнее понимать во актуальных технологиях создания. Данное ап икс создает картину про этой теме, каким образом разрабатываются, проверяются а также развертываются онлайн продукты.

Что представляют собой проверочные среды

Что представляют собой проверочные среды

Тестовые среды представляют из себя отдельные пространства, при каких тестируется работа цифрового обеспечения раньше его использования при основной платформе. Эти окружения создаются ради данного, для того чтобы обнаруживать сбои, анализировать работу приложения а также проверять стабильность изменений без вероятности по отношению к стабильной работы продукта. Данные среды имитируют настройки реальной работы, однако не up x сказываются на клиентов а также ключевые сценарии.

Во процессе программирования испытательные окружения играют значимую роль. Вспомогательные источники, такие например ап х, помогают выяснить структуру окружений плюс механизмы этих сред применения. Главное значение отводится точности воспроизведения настроек, устойчивости эксплуатации плюс потенциалу контролируемого валидации различных сценариев.

Назначение тестовых сред

Основная функция проверочной среды — предоставить защищенное пространство с целью валидации изменений. Всякая новая функция, исправление дефекта либо изменение системы на старте проверяется во отдельном пространстве. Данное дает возможность найти сбои перед того, пока они воздействуют по рабочую платформу.

Тестовые инфраструктуры тоже используются для оценки взаимодействия. Программа способно работать по хранилищами информации, сторонними службами плюс служебными компонентами. При проверочной области возможно понять, когда каждые модули действуют ап икс официальный сайт правильно вместе.

Также другой функцией выступает проверка производительности. В тестовом контуре моделируется интенсивность, дабы выяснить, по какому принципу платформа ведет поведение при крупном числе действий. Такое помогает найти узкие места и сначала подготовиться к повышению активности.

Виды тестовых сред

Используется ряд видов тестовых сред. Разработка как правило запускается во персональной инфраструктуре, в которой программист тестирует конкретные обновления. Данная среда отличается значительной подвижностью а также помогает быстро делать корректировки.

Другим уровнем выступает связующая инфраструктура. Тут тестируется взаимодействие различных модулей платформы. Главная задача — проверить, когда модули стабильно передают информацией и никак не вызывают сбоев.

Staging-среда максимально адаптирована под продуктовой. В данном контуре тестируется готовая версия приложения до релизом. Это позволяет оценить реакцию системы в настройках, близких к рабочим.

Кроме того имеет возможность использоваться самостоятельная инфраструктура с целью нагрузочного тестирования. При данном контуре создается высокая нагрузка, чтобы проверить стабильность платформы а также такой платформы способность принимать значительное объем операций.

Организация тестовой среды

Тестовая инфраструктура содержит набор частей. Основу формирует стенд либо группа узлов, на которых запускается сервис. Дополнительно применяются системы информации, системы размещения а также интернет up x модули.

Параметры инфраструктуры должна отвечать рабочим условиям. Такое включает версий цифрового софта, параметров узлов а также схемы данных. Если точнее инфраструктура имитирует боевую систему, тем стабильнее итоги валидации.

Кроме того способны задействоваться тестовые сведения. Они повторяют реальные записи, при этом совсем не имеют конфиденциальной данных. Такие материалы позволяют оценить механику функционирования приложения вне угрозы потери сведений.

Управление данными во испытательной области

Обращение по данными требует особого подхода. В проверочной инфраструктуре применяются дубликаты или заранее сформированные комплекты ап икс официальный сайт информации. Данное помогает повторять различные варианты плюс оценивать реакцию платформы в разных условиях.

Следует отслеживать актуальность сведений. В случае если сведения устарела, итоги тестирования способны оказаться ошибочными. Следовательно информация периодически актуализируются или создаются заново.

Дополнительно необходимо учитывать сохранность. Тестовые данные не могут включать фактическую частную сведения. Для данного используются механизмы скрытия плюс ап икс создания искусственных наборов.

Автоматизация проверочных окружений

Современные системы программирования широко применяют автоматизацию. Проверочные инфраструктуры могут создаваться и подготавливаться автоматически. Это дает возможность своевременно запускать среду ради валидации обновлений.

Автоматизация предполагает настройку серверов, установку зависимостей и загрузку информации. Подобный принцип уменьшает частоту ошибок и облегчает механизм проверки.

Кроме того механизируется очистка и актуализация инфраструктуры. По завершении завершения тестирования окружение может стать сброшено а также пересоздано. Данное обеспечивает стабильность и снижает накопление ошибок up x.

Связь по CI/CD циклами

Проверочные среды прочно соотнесены по CI/CD. В случае очередном изменении программы самостоятельно выполняются пайплайны, что применяют проверочные инфраструктуры ради тестирования. Данное дает возможность быстро выявлять ошибки и предотвращать их передачу.

Каждый этап CI/CD имеет возможность использовать конкретную инфраструктуру. Так, интеграционные валидации выполняются во отдельной инфраструктуре, и итоговая проверка — в другой. Данный принцип повышает устойчивость сервиса.

Самостоятельное подключение с испытательными средами формирует процесс разработки гораздо понятным. Каждые обновления выполняют одинаковую схему валидаций.

Контроль корректности

Контроль корректности является ключевой функцией испытательных сред. В этих средах выполняются разные виды проверки: функциональное, межкомпонентное, нагрузочное и контрольное. Любой вид валидации измеряет определенный параметр функционирования системы.

Выводы тестирования записываются а также анализируются. Когда найдены ошибки, изменения отправляются к исправление. Это снижает проникновение проблем ап икс в боевую среду.

Периодическое тестирование дает возможность сохранять надежность системы. Даже при ограниченные обновления могут воздействовать по работу приложения, поэтому валидация осуществляется систематически.

Распространенные проблемы при использовании проверочных инфраструктур

Распространенной из частых проблем становится несоответствие окружения рабочим параметрам. Когда настройка отличается, итоги валидации способны быть ошибочными. Такое ведет к ошибкам по завершении развертывания.

Еще отдельной ошибкой является использование старых сведений. В этом варианте проверка не показывает up x актуальную ситуацию, плюс проблемы могут сохраниться незамеченными.

Дополнительно появляется недостаточная самостоятельность. Если испытательная область соединена по рабочей инфраструктурой, существует вероятность эффекта на рабочие записи. Данное имеет возможность подвести до серьезным последствиям.

Защита тестовых инфраструктур

Тестовые среды должны быть закрыты так же же образом, подобно и продуктовые платформы. Они могут хранить значимую сведения насчет устройстве программы а также его логике. Потому доступ ап икс официальный сайт к таким окружениям должен являться закрыт.

Используются методы ограничения входа, шифрования а также мониторинга. Это дает возможность предотвратить несанкционированное применение среды.

Также следует наблюдать по актуализацией прикладного ПО. Неактуальные компоненты имеют возможность включать уязвимости, что могут быть использованы посторонними лицами ап икс.

Контроль проверочных сред

Мониторинг помогает отслеживать работу проверочной инфраструктуры. Данный механизм отображает загрузку мощностей, дефекты а также производительность. Данное помогает обнаруживать сбои не исключительно в сервисе, однако также при самой инфраструктуре.

Регулярное отслеживание позволяет поддерживать устойчивость инфраструктуры. Если мощности исчерпываются или формируются ошибки, данное может сказаться по выводы проверки.

Мониторинг дополнительно помогает настраивать распределение средств. Данное особенно существенно во время взаимодействии через разными окружениями параллельно.

Дополнительные аспекты проверочных окружений

Ключевым из существенных направлений выступает учет редакциями инфраструктуры. Разные шаги программирования могут требовать разных параметров плюс условий. Потому ап икс официальный сайт необходимо фиксировать условия среды и отслеживать изменения. Данное дает возможность создавать настройки проверки а также избегать расхождений между выводами.

Также задействуется метод краткосрочных сред. Ради каждой задачи либо проверки разворачивается самостоятельная инфраструктура, которая устраняется после выполнения проверки. Это дает возможность тестировать обновления самостоятельно плюс снижает вероятность сбоев внутри отдельными редакциями программы.

Также другим направлением становится интеграция с решениями программирования. Проверочные среды могут автоматически ап икс интегрироваться до платформам управления версий, CI/CD цепочкам а также средствам контроля. Это формирует процесс тестирования намного быстрым плюс контролируемым.

Улучшение эксплуатации тестовых инфраструктур

Для результативной поддержки важно улучшать средства. Создание а также сопровождение окружения нуждается вычислительных ресурсов, следовательно важно проверять эти ресурсы занятость. Самостоятельное остановка простаивающих инфраструктур позволяет up x снизить расход ресурсов.

Настройка тоже охватывает конфигурацию процессов. Совсем не все проверки должны проводиться во одной инфраструктуре. Деление проверок среди средами повышает скорость тестирование и сокращает период простоя.

Регулярный разбор работы проверочных инфраструктур дает возможность обнаруживать проблемные места. В случае если проверки работают затяжно или регулярно формируются ошибки, настройки необходимо корректировать. Это формирует систему намного надежной плюс результативной ап икс официальный сайт.

Реальное назначение испытательных сред

Испытательные среды используются на многих этапах программирования. Такие среды позволяют обнаруживать сбои, проверять правки а также повышать надежность продукта. При отсутствии данных сред угроза ошибок во продуктовой системе существенно повышается.

Правильно настроенные испытательные инфраструктуры формируют механизм создания более предсказуемым. Каждое изменение проходит валидацию, что сокращает вероятность внезапных сбоев.

Осознание основ работы проверочных окружений дает возможность глубже ориентироваться в актуальных инструментах программирования. Данное ап икс дает картину о этой теме, по какому принципу разрабатываются, валидируются плюс развертываются цифровые продукты.